Posted November 29, 2010

Greater Portland Christian School provides a distinctively Christian education which complements the home and church, brings Biblical perspective to every subject, and helps parents prepare their children for a God-glorifying life. Here is some of what GPCS offers: - All Maine state certified, experienced Christian teachers - Preschool, whole day kindergarten plus Grades 1-12 - Quality curriculum filtered through the truth of God's Word - College preparatory focus for Grades 9-12 - High academic standards - Supportive peer groups and Christian fellowship - Small class size, low student/teacher ratio - Computer network, fully-equipped science lab, and gymnasium - Class D Soccer and Basketball and Class C Track - Drama, music, yearbook, and more - Opportunities to join our dedicated team of parents - Spirit of unity and cooperation in a multi-denominational, parent-sponsored, Christian school
—Submitted by a parent

We currently do not have any test score information for this school. Unlike public schools, private schools are not always required to report data about their schools or not required to take the same tests as public schools. Many private schools take different standardized tests; however, that information is often made available only to families of enrolled students.
